What are the signs of problems in building extensions in Runcorn?
When considering building extensions in Runcorn, it's crucial to be aware of potential signs of problems that may arise. Cracks in the walls or ceilings, particularly around windows and doors, can indicate foundation issues. Additionally, if you notice bubbling or peeling paint, this may suggest moisture problems that could lead to structural damage. Another common sign is uneven floors; if you feel a noticeable incline or dip, it's a red flag.
Cost for repairs can vary greatly based on the severity of the issue. Minor repairs might cost around £500–£1,500, while significant structural fixes can escalate to £3,000 or more. It's essential to engage professionals with relevant certifications like Building Regulations approval and those who are registered with the Federation of Master Builders. This ensures that your project adheres to safety and quality standards, especially in older homes typical of Runcorn.
If you suspect problems, it's wise to consult a local building expert to evaluate and provide solutions.
